Well for starters get your adaptability up to at least 25 I think. You'll get more invincibility frames when you roll but after 25-30 you won't see that much of a significant change without having to put a lot of souls into leveling it up. For weapons, I vary from 1h to GS to UGS. The Varangian, although a low drop rate, is excellent and you can get it, with patience, at the place where it's extremely dark and you have to go on a boat. For a UGS, beat the pursuer boss fight and get his soul to make his sword later on. Conveniently, after that boss fight there's a place you can drop down in his fighting room where you can get a nice GS and a good set of armor.

Try to get the Sun Sword, you get it at rank 3 in the Sunbro covenant (I forget the name of it.) it starts out with B scaling in both strength and dex and goes to A when fully reinforced.

But the Alva armor from maughlin the armorer in Majula. You need to spend 16000 souls before it becomes available. The whole set costs 25000 souls. I recommend farming Heidi's tower. Try to get a Heide knight sword as well. It's too good.

Get used to rolling and when to roll to avoid any damage. Practice on low damage guys in the beginning. I don't usually pay attention to armor until I get further in the game and can get the set I want. I use a long sword upgraded until I get the greatsword. I have a high strength build with low armor because I dodge everything Even though I use the greatsword which is slow I play like a dex player. But for beginners if dodging is a little too hard for you to get used to definitely find a shield that blocks most if not all physical damage and block everything. Sorry I don't know the names of any armor I use in beginning or any shields. :( get good at rolling and striking then rolling away again. And have lots of patience :p
